In 2015, Center for Balanced Health implemented Advanced MD Scheduling as its Medical Scheduling Software to support a busy two-office, ten-provider multi-specialty practice in the United States. The deployment used the AdvancedMD cloud system to centralize appointment books, provide real-time availability across both sites, and standardize patient intake and scheduling workflows for front-desk and clinical staff. Advanced MD Scheduling was implemented alongside a seamlessly integrated EHR, enabling a practical migration path to total automation and automating key administrative workflows such as appointment confirmations, scheduling rules enforcement, and task routing to clinical teams. Operational scope included front-office scheduling, patient flow coordination, and revenue cycle touchpoints, which freed staff to focus on patient care, reduced after-hours paperwork, and resulted in one fewer FTE while improving timeliness of reimbursement collection and service levels for a demanding patient population.

Center for Balanced Health is a Healthcare organization based in United States, with around 20 employees and annual revenues of $1.0 million.

Center for Balanced Health oper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as Advanced MD Scheduling and Google Workspace (Formerly Google G-Suite), covering areas like Medical Practice Management and Collaboration.

Center for Balanced Health has invested in cloud applications and AI-driven platforms to optimize efficiency and growth, collaborating with vendors such as AdvancedMD and Google.

Center for Balanced Health recently adopted applications including Advanced MD Scheduling in 2015 and Google Workspace (Formerly Google G-Suite) in 2014, highlighting its ongoing modernization strategy.
